I think i'll do a "chmod 666 /var/log/httpd/suexec.log" and see if the error goes away.
I think what the problem is, i have the owner and group as root:root with read/write permissions, but apache is likely owned by something else (www:www or apache:webservd). So either i'll have to change the group ownership of the log file to the group apache is running as or change the log file to world read/write, which isn't safe since other people log into the box, but is generally harmless i think with log files.
